Is epicanthus a word?

noun, plural ep i can thi [ep-i-kan-thahy, -thee]. Anatomy. A skin fold that extends from the eyelid to the inner canthus, common in Asian populations.

What are the types of epicanthus?

There are 4 types of epicanthus:

  • Epicanthus tarsalis: Most prominent along the upper eyelid fold.
  • Epicanthus: Most prominent along the lower eyelid.
  • Epicanthus palpebralis: involves the upper and lower eyelids.
  • Epicanthus superciliaris: The folds originate on the forehead and extend down to the lacrimal sac.

Are small eyes a birth defect?

microphthalmia is a birth defect in which one or both eyes are not fully developed, so they are small.
